Honecker Bunker

Object 17 5001-19 was popularly called the Honeker bunker, near Prenden This nuclear bunker was built for the leadership of the former GDR It was constructed in such a way that it could withstand a direct impact from a nuclear warhead, and the occupants were then self-sufficient for about 20 days could stay in the bunker.

Large parts of the three-storey facility are oscillating in order to be able to intercept the seismic wave of a nuclear weapon detonation. For this purpose, spring mechanisms and nitrogen-filled pneumocord shock absorbers (PKU) were used to absorb shock waves of up to 14 g to 1 g.

The bunker was completed in 1983 after 5 years of construction

The actual bunker has not been accessible for several years. Economic buildings, sports facilities, workshops .. tell their own story.
